Release
The K&D Sessions as released on October 5, 1998 in both a two compact disc set or a four vinyl record set by Studio !K7. On February 28, 1999, Kruder & Dorfmeister started on a ten city tour of North America to promote the album.
After the release and success of the album, the group received several requests to remix their music which they turned down. Dorfmeister stated that they had "felt like we'd already done it," and "I'd rather release nothing than something that is half and half...Perhaps we don't have so much output, but at least then we don't release some bullshit."
